Output 832791f069cf7586de09a783514ce77f1d66f6d923c4519203d4d343b2c27406:8

value
2518841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f908178fbb056e2c7d11a953ca8734ca1ef922 OP_EQUAL
address
3B5VB8VfjygLnpF1Tbb1hs22te7m6uFhn7
transaction
832791f069cf7586de09a783514ce77f1d66f6d923c4519203d4d343b2c27406
spent
true